01-22-2023, 10:37 AM
Why You Should Seriously Consider Implementing DNS Forwarders for Effective Name Resolution
When it comes to efficient name resolution in your networks, DNS forwarders play a pivotal role that you simply can't overlook. As you continue to set up and manage your infrastructure, I find that many of us tend to overlook the necessity of DNS forwarders. You might think that using your local DNS-only server could suffice, but forwarding DNS queries to another server or even multiple servers adds a layer of efficiency and reliability that you shouldn't dismiss. By avoiding direct queries to the root servers or relying solely on your main DNS server, you can significantly reduce latency in query resolution and increase the resilience of your DNS operations. It transforms the way you handle heavy workloads and makes you more efficient in processing those requests. You want speed, and that's something DNS forwarders deliver.
DNS forwarders also mitigate the strain on your DNS servers, freeing them up for more essential tasks. Without forwarders, each DNS server in your organization has to resolve every query by going through the whole resolution process, which takes its toll on performance and responsiveness. By forwarding queries, you redirect that job to specialized DNS servers that are optimized for the task. This decentralizes loads across your network, distributing those demands rather than piling everything onto a single server or a handful of them. Picture a busy highway: if too many cars try to merge around the same exit, everything slows down, right? Forwarders help keep the traffic flowing smoothly by allowing queries to reach their destinations faster.
You might be working in an environment where operational simplicity feels like the key. Skipping DNS forwarders seems appealing at first, but I assure you, you might face more headaches in the long run. Automating the DNS infrastructure with forwarders significantly reduces the chances of misconfiguration, which inevitably leads to downtime or poor user experiences. By implementing forwarders, you establish a clear pathway for queries. This not only streamlines the communication process but allows every member of your team to troubleshoot effectively since they can quickly track down failed requests and isolate the problem to specific forwarders or resolver configurations. Being proactive in design saves countless hours when issues arise.
Lookup failures happen, and you know that they can be critical. Failover strategies need to be in place in any robust IT environment. When you send queries to a DNS forwarder, you're also leveraging that system's intelligence, especially if it employs caching mechanisms. That means even if the original request fails, the forwarder retains previous resolutions which can be reused. While relying on a single source can lead to repeated failures during peak loads or outages, using forwarders introduces resiliency, allowing you to take those misfortunes in stride rather than letting them cripple operations. Envision a situation where you have a key application down due to name resolution issues. Applying forwarders minimizes the chances of that happening because they can access cached records, providing quicker responses in emergencies.
Enhanced Security and Control Over Your DNS Environment
Implementing DNS forwarders enhances your security posture. Forwarders can filter or redirect requests, which acts as a first line of defense against malicious queries or traffic intended for harmful domains. When you route queries through a controlled environment, you gain the ability to analyze and monitor those DNS requests for any suspicious activity or patterns. Plus, you can implement strong firewall rules that limit what domains can be resolved, giving you an additional layer of security. As an IT professional, you'll appreciate how this centralization of control makes it easier to manage threat detection and response. Being able to pinpoint the origins of anomalies helps you tackle potential breaches quicker and more effectively.
Your organization might host multiple domains or services within different segments, and forwarders allow you to streamline access while maintaining a robust security framework. You get to grant access only to specific forwarders for different departments, reducing unnecessary exposure of your internal servers to the outside world. This way, you respect the principle of least privilege, giving each department access only to those DNS records relevant to them. It's like giving each user just the right tools for their job-no more, no less. You want to create a configuration where even if someone tries to perform a DNS-based attack within your boundaries, their reach remains limited. Forwarders can help encapsulate that, giving you tighter control over your DNS services.
Finely tuning your DNS environment becomes more manageable with a well-planned forwarder strategy. Imagine having dedicated forwarders for specific functions, such as handling non-essential requests, internal domain queries, or even vendor-specific resolutions. This setup allows you to direct traffic intelligently and optimize how you distribute workloads. Instead of existing in a haphazard state, your network benefits from clear pathways that allow each query to be resolved where it makes the most sense. Whether you're running a test environment or production services, managing those dedicated forwarders makes a world of difference in performance and reliability.
It's easy to overlook metrics when it comes to DNS performance, especially as the focus often falls on user-facing services. However, logging the interactions through your forwarders yields crucial data. You'll gain insights into query loads, response times, and failure rates. These metrics not only allow you to fine-tune performance by adding or reconfiguring forwarders, but they also help you pinpoint periods of excessive load or spots where optimization is still needed. You can measure the effectiveness of a forwarder by how well it handles the demands placed on it, and if it falls short, you can quickly pivot by testing alternative forwarders or configurations.
Effective Troubleshooting While Using DNS Forwarders
Troubleshooting DNS issues becomes significantly easier with the proper use of forwarders. You can quickly isolate problems by observing query performance from various forwarders, which streamlines your approach to maintaining your network. If one forwarder starts to return errors or is unresponsive, it doesn't necessarily bring down the entire system. Instead, you can switch traffic to other available forwarders while investigating the root cause. By funneling your queries through designated forwarders, you create an environment where you can pinpoint discrepancies more effectively. Every query can generate logs that make identifying issues straightforward and immediate, leading to less downtime while you analyze and resolve concerns.
As you gain experience with your DNS setup, you'll start recognizing patterns, and with forwarders, those patterns become audible. You can trace back the steps of each query to see how they route and where potential bottlenecks occur. Each forwarder can be seen as a checkpoint that signals its efficiency and reliability. You may run tests by deliberately causing issues if you want to access your forwarder's responses actively. The feedback you receive will be invaluable in shaping your ongoing DNS strategy. In a world where every second counts, having this level of insight aids in making decisions about scaling your infrastructure or adjusting your DNS architecture.
Your DNS health monitoring strategy can adapt and change because forwarders give you flexibility. If they start hitting response limits or failing regularly, it signals that either too many queries are directed to them or perhaps they lack the resources to cope with the traffic. Forwarders can help you distribute load more effectively, letting you shift resources dynamically as you encounter more demanding situations. Running tests regularly on these forwarders, alongside your existing quotas for response times, can yield information that directly translates into improved service. The organic flow of traffic through your DNS allows you to remain proactive, identifying and rectifying issues before they impact user experience.
Could your environment benefit from a staged rollout of solutions? DNS forwarders lend themselves well to incremental changes, enabling you to introduce them into your system without disrupting operations. Whether you're moving to a new infrastructure or optimizing your existing setup, forwarders allow teams to gauge performance before fully committing to new configurations. It takes the guesswork out of DNS response times and helps in illustrating the impact of the changes you've made. From one user's experience to another, you develop the ability to adjust strategies according to the actual performance you're seeing.
Embracing Innovation with Efficient DNS Forwarders
Innovation in your networking strategies isn't just a buzzword-it's imperative in staying competitive. DNS forwarders represent an important transition point in modern architecture that aligns with a broader push for smarter, more flexible infrastructures that you want to cultivate. They enable solutions that reflect the current demands placed on your systems while also preparing you for future growth. This might involve integrating cloud-based DNS resolve services or collaborating with external APIs that leverage advanced analytics. Forwarders smooth the transition, ensuring every request you encounter can be elegantly managed without the headache of a time-consuming overhaul.
Moving towards a more cloud-oriented world involves embracing change at every level of your stack. Forwarders facilitate such changes by allowing your environment the flexibility needed to integrate newer DNS technologies without completely reforming your existing framework. The moment you can shift some DNS queries to cloud services or third-party solutions, you'll notice changes in resolution times and response statistics, demonstrating core improvements in service delivery to your users. Each contribution serves as a step forward, reinforcing the overall architecture you build to support your operations.
With the modern user's expectations in constant fluctuation, DNS forwarders give you a strategic advantage in ensuring that you meet those requirements. I suggest constantly assessing your querying standards. Forwarders integrate easily with different systems and can become pivotal in fulfilling service level agreements. When they're in place, you position yourself to handle loads dynamically, giving your service the resilience essential for day-to-day operations. You're not just building a network anymore; you're creating an adaptable environment capable of responding to rapid changes.
This agile adaptation proves beneficial for small to mid-sized businesses that might not have the luxury of vast operational bandwidth. Forwarders allow those smaller environments to benefit from efficiencies traditionally limited to larger enterprises. It levels the playing field, giving you the prowess to manage your queries more effectively without the requirements of a large-scale deployment. Scalable solutions often bring peace of mind when the business starts growing and requires prompt adjustments to support those changes.
I would like to introduce you to BackupChain, a reliable and popular backup solution crafted especially for SMBs and professionals. This robust platform offers protection for Hyper-V, VMware, and Windows Server. It's impressively designed to cater to your operational needs while providing a useful glossary free of charge. You have a powerful backup option at your disposal that doesn't just protect your data, but also enhances your understanding of the environment you work within.
When it comes to efficient name resolution in your networks, DNS forwarders play a pivotal role that you simply can't overlook. As you continue to set up and manage your infrastructure, I find that many of us tend to overlook the necessity of DNS forwarders. You might think that using your local DNS-only server could suffice, but forwarding DNS queries to another server or even multiple servers adds a layer of efficiency and reliability that you shouldn't dismiss. By avoiding direct queries to the root servers or relying solely on your main DNS server, you can significantly reduce latency in query resolution and increase the resilience of your DNS operations. It transforms the way you handle heavy workloads and makes you more efficient in processing those requests. You want speed, and that's something DNS forwarders deliver.
DNS forwarders also mitigate the strain on your DNS servers, freeing them up for more essential tasks. Without forwarders, each DNS server in your organization has to resolve every query by going through the whole resolution process, which takes its toll on performance and responsiveness. By forwarding queries, you redirect that job to specialized DNS servers that are optimized for the task. This decentralizes loads across your network, distributing those demands rather than piling everything onto a single server or a handful of them. Picture a busy highway: if too many cars try to merge around the same exit, everything slows down, right? Forwarders help keep the traffic flowing smoothly by allowing queries to reach their destinations faster.
You might be working in an environment where operational simplicity feels like the key. Skipping DNS forwarders seems appealing at first, but I assure you, you might face more headaches in the long run. Automating the DNS infrastructure with forwarders significantly reduces the chances of misconfiguration, which inevitably leads to downtime or poor user experiences. By implementing forwarders, you establish a clear pathway for queries. This not only streamlines the communication process but allows every member of your team to troubleshoot effectively since they can quickly track down failed requests and isolate the problem to specific forwarders or resolver configurations. Being proactive in design saves countless hours when issues arise.
Lookup failures happen, and you know that they can be critical. Failover strategies need to be in place in any robust IT environment. When you send queries to a DNS forwarder, you're also leveraging that system's intelligence, especially if it employs caching mechanisms. That means even if the original request fails, the forwarder retains previous resolutions which can be reused. While relying on a single source can lead to repeated failures during peak loads or outages, using forwarders introduces resiliency, allowing you to take those misfortunes in stride rather than letting them cripple operations. Envision a situation where you have a key application down due to name resolution issues. Applying forwarders minimizes the chances of that happening because they can access cached records, providing quicker responses in emergencies.
Enhanced Security and Control Over Your DNS Environment
Implementing DNS forwarders enhances your security posture. Forwarders can filter or redirect requests, which acts as a first line of defense against malicious queries or traffic intended for harmful domains. When you route queries through a controlled environment, you gain the ability to analyze and monitor those DNS requests for any suspicious activity or patterns. Plus, you can implement strong firewall rules that limit what domains can be resolved, giving you an additional layer of security. As an IT professional, you'll appreciate how this centralization of control makes it easier to manage threat detection and response. Being able to pinpoint the origins of anomalies helps you tackle potential breaches quicker and more effectively.
Your organization might host multiple domains or services within different segments, and forwarders allow you to streamline access while maintaining a robust security framework. You get to grant access only to specific forwarders for different departments, reducing unnecessary exposure of your internal servers to the outside world. This way, you respect the principle of least privilege, giving each department access only to those DNS records relevant to them. It's like giving each user just the right tools for their job-no more, no less. You want to create a configuration where even if someone tries to perform a DNS-based attack within your boundaries, their reach remains limited. Forwarders can help encapsulate that, giving you tighter control over your DNS services.
Finely tuning your DNS environment becomes more manageable with a well-planned forwarder strategy. Imagine having dedicated forwarders for specific functions, such as handling non-essential requests, internal domain queries, or even vendor-specific resolutions. This setup allows you to direct traffic intelligently and optimize how you distribute workloads. Instead of existing in a haphazard state, your network benefits from clear pathways that allow each query to be resolved where it makes the most sense. Whether you're running a test environment or production services, managing those dedicated forwarders makes a world of difference in performance and reliability.
It's easy to overlook metrics when it comes to DNS performance, especially as the focus often falls on user-facing services. However, logging the interactions through your forwarders yields crucial data. You'll gain insights into query loads, response times, and failure rates. These metrics not only allow you to fine-tune performance by adding or reconfiguring forwarders, but they also help you pinpoint periods of excessive load or spots where optimization is still needed. You can measure the effectiveness of a forwarder by how well it handles the demands placed on it, and if it falls short, you can quickly pivot by testing alternative forwarders or configurations.
Effective Troubleshooting While Using DNS Forwarders
Troubleshooting DNS issues becomes significantly easier with the proper use of forwarders. You can quickly isolate problems by observing query performance from various forwarders, which streamlines your approach to maintaining your network. If one forwarder starts to return errors or is unresponsive, it doesn't necessarily bring down the entire system. Instead, you can switch traffic to other available forwarders while investigating the root cause. By funneling your queries through designated forwarders, you create an environment where you can pinpoint discrepancies more effectively. Every query can generate logs that make identifying issues straightforward and immediate, leading to less downtime while you analyze and resolve concerns.
As you gain experience with your DNS setup, you'll start recognizing patterns, and with forwarders, those patterns become audible. You can trace back the steps of each query to see how they route and where potential bottlenecks occur. Each forwarder can be seen as a checkpoint that signals its efficiency and reliability. You may run tests by deliberately causing issues if you want to access your forwarder's responses actively. The feedback you receive will be invaluable in shaping your ongoing DNS strategy. In a world where every second counts, having this level of insight aids in making decisions about scaling your infrastructure or adjusting your DNS architecture.
Your DNS health monitoring strategy can adapt and change because forwarders give you flexibility. If they start hitting response limits or failing regularly, it signals that either too many queries are directed to them or perhaps they lack the resources to cope with the traffic. Forwarders can help you distribute load more effectively, letting you shift resources dynamically as you encounter more demanding situations. Running tests regularly on these forwarders, alongside your existing quotas for response times, can yield information that directly translates into improved service. The organic flow of traffic through your DNS allows you to remain proactive, identifying and rectifying issues before they impact user experience.
Could your environment benefit from a staged rollout of solutions? DNS forwarders lend themselves well to incremental changes, enabling you to introduce them into your system without disrupting operations. Whether you're moving to a new infrastructure or optimizing your existing setup, forwarders allow teams to gauge performance before fully committing to new configurations. It takes the guesswork out of DNS response times and helps in illustrating the impact of the changes you've made. From one user's experience to another, you develop the ability to adjust strategies according to the actual performance you're seeing.
Embracing Innovation with Efficient DNS Forwarders
Innovation in your networking strategies isn't just a buzzword-it's imperative in staying competitive. DNS forwarders represent an important transition point in modern architecture that aligns with a broader push for smarter, more flexible infrastructures that you want to cultivate. They enable solutions that reflect the current demands placed on your systems while also preparing you for future growth. This might involve integrating cloud-based DNS resolve services or collaborating with external APIs that leverage advanced analytics. Forwarders smooth the transition, ensuring every request you encounter can be elegantly managed without the headache of a time-consuming overhaul.
Moving towards a more cloud-oriented world involves embracing change at every level of your stack. Forwarders facilitate such changes by allowing your environment the flexibility needed to integrate newer DNS technologies without completely reforming your existing framework. The moment you can shift some DNS queries to cloud services or third-party solutions, you'll notice changes in resolution times and response statistics, demonstrating core improvements in service delivery to your users. Each contribution serves as a step forward, reinforcing the overall architecture you build to support your operations.
With the modern user's expectations in constant fluctuation, DNS forwarders give you a strategic advantage in ensuring that you meet those requirements. I suggest constantly assessing your querying standards. Forwarders integrate easily with different systems and can become pivotal in fulfilling service level agreements. When they're in place, you position yourself to handle loads dynamically, giving your service the resilience essential for day-to-day operations. You're not just building a network anymore; you're creating an adaptable environment capable of responding to rapid changes.
This agile adaptation proves beneficial for small to mid-sized businesses that might not have the luxury of vast operational bandwidth. Forwarders allow those smaller environments to benefit from efficiencies traditionally limited to larger enterprises. It levels the playing field, giving you the prowess to manage your queries more effectively without the requirements of a large-scale deployment. Scalable solutions often bring peace of mind when the business starts growing and requires prompt adjustments to support those changes.
I would like to introduce you to BackupChain, a reliable and popular backup solution crafted especially for SMBs and professionals. This robust platform offers protection for Hyper-V, VMware, and Windows Server. It's impressively designed to cater to your operational needs while providing a useful glossary free of charge. You have a powerful backup option at your disposal that doesn't just protect your data, but also enhances your understanding of the environment you work within.
